Western Digital Energy Saving Hard Disk

Finally, Western Digital is leading the hard disk industry in bring out energy saving hard disk, according to source, The GreenPower family will ship in capacities from 320 Gbytes to 1 terabyte and will use 40% less energy than other similar products.
The GreenPower drives only consume about 8.5 watts compare to Hitachi’s 13.5 watts, currently it is only available in 3.5 inch format, if Western Digital has the ability to further reduce the energy consumption and comes in a 2.5 inch format for the laptop, they have a winner.
